Marcus J Wilson – Owner

Marcus J Wilson, Pooka.Pro OwnerPooka.Pro was established by experienced arts marketer and web developer Marcus J Wilson.

Marcus is a former Broadband Britain Champion for his work on the Northings website (www.northings.com), which is the arts magazine and social network for arts and culture in northern Scotland.

Between 2003 and 2005, Marcus project managed a £250,000 project to develop an online ticketing service for the Highlands and Islands of Scotland.  The Booth (www.thebooth.co.uk) quickly achieved all projected client adoption and income targets set, and Booth Scotland Ltd became an independent company in 2007, and has since rolled-out to service cultural organisations across Scotland.  As a result, Marcus sat on the Scottish Government’s National Box Office Scoping Group in 2007.

Marcus is currently a Reference Group member for Creative Scotland’s national Amb:IT:ion programme, which is engaged with over 200 cultural organisations across Scotland, funding a range of these to take forward major web development projects for their organisations.

Marcus runs the weekly Joomla! Breakfast in Edinburgh, a discussion group for Open Source developers using Joomla! CMS.
